The Putnam County Community Foundation (PCCF) is preparing for the upcoming Share the Dream program which begins Tuesday, October 1, 2024.
This year, PCCF’s Philanthropic Development Committee is offering an endowment building opportunity for 12 of its component funds which are working toward endowment status. “We are excited to see the impact of the eligible funds grow with the help of generous community members during the Share the Dream program,”commented Neysa Meyer, Executive Director of the Putnam County Community Foundation. “The power of endowment can make an immeasurable difference to Putnam County. A $50,000 gift today can grow to $150,000 in 50 years even while providing over triple its initial value in grants to support the community.”
Share the Dream will run from October 1-31. Eligible funds must receive qualifying donations totaling a minimum of $250 during the program dates to receive a portion of $30,000 endowment building grant. The first $500 in qualifying donations made will be matched dollar for dollar. Donations beyond the first $500 will be matched proportionally with the remaining match grant dollars across all participating funds.
All cash and check donations must be received at the Putnam County Community Foundation between 8:30 AM on Tuesday, October 1 and 5:00 PM on Thursday, October 31. Checks dated or received outside the program dates will not qualify. Online gifts may qualify if they are made between 12:00 AM on Tuesday, October 1 and 11:59 PM on Thursday, October 31 at pcfoundation.org.
